HOUSE BILL 1449

 

AN ACT limiting times vaccine clinics may operate at schools and requiring parents or legal guardians to be present with their child during the administration of vaccinations at such a clinic.

 

SPONSORS: Rep. McGrath, Rock. 40; Rep. DeRoy, Straf. 3; Rep. DeVito, Rock. 8; Rep. Litchfield, Rock. 32; Rep. McFarlane, Graf. 18; Rep. Morton, Hills. 39; Rep. Perez, Rock. 16; Rep. Sabourin dit Choiniere, Rock. 30; Rep. Terry, Belk. 7

 

COMMITTEE: Health, Human Services and Elderly Affairs

 

-----------------------------------------------------------------

 

ANALYSIS

 

This bill prohibits the operation of a vaccination clinic at schools during school hours and requires the parent or legal guardian of a child be present during the administration of any vaccination to their child at such a clinic.

1  New Section; School Vaccination Clinics; Parent or Legal Guardian Required.  Amend RSA 200 by inserting after section 27-a the following new section:  

200:27-b  School Vaccination Clinics; Parent or Legal Guardian Required.

I.  No public elementary or secondary school or chartered public school shall conduct a vaccination clinic at any time during school hours.  

II.  A parent or guardian of a child shall be required to accompany and be present with their child in order for a child to be immunized at a vaccination clinic held in a public elementary or secondary school or chartered public school.  

III.  Nothing in this section shall effect the duties of school nurses as described in RSA 200:38, I(a).   

2  Effective Date.  This act shall take effect 60 days after its passage.
